WebJul 21, 2024 · How to Lock a Word Document in macOS Open the Word document that you wish to protect. Go to the Review tab, located near the top of the Word interface. Select … WebAug 9, 2024 · Launch Microsoft Word and click File>Open and find the document you wish to password protect. Click File again and select Info from the left pane. Select Protect Document. From the drop down menu, select Encrypt with Password. Enter a password that you can remember and that’ll be required when anyone attempts to open this document.
